| Rank | Firm | Assets (in millions) |
|---|---|---|
| 1 | J.P. Morgan Asset Management | $148,600.0 |
| 2 | Morgan Stanley | $114,600.0 |
| 3 | BlackRock Inc. | $53,603.0 |
| 4 | Invesco | $16,762.2 |
| 5 | Pacific Investment Management Co. LLC | $15,253.0 |
| 6 | BNY Mellon Asset Management | $12,132.0 |
| 7 | PNC Financial Services Group Inc. | $11,500.0 |
| 8 | Franklin Templeton Investments | $10,636.0 |
| 9 | Ashmore Investment Management Ltd. | $8,400.0 |
| 10 | Parametric Portfolio Associates | $7,861.2 |
| 11 | Davis Selected Advisers LP | $6,275.0 |
| 12 | Oaktree Capital Management LP | $3,913.0 |
| 13 | BMO Asset Management | $3,848.0 |
| 14 | Tocqueville Asset Management LP | $3,779.4 |
| 15 | Eaton Vance Management | $3,117.0 |
| 16 | State Street Global Advisors | $2,724.0 |
| 17 | Tweedy Browne Co. LLC | $2,597.2 |
| 18 | Hines | $2,574.0 |
| 19 | Payden & Rygel | $2,463.0 |
| 20 | Brown Brothers Harriman & Co. | $2,074.0 |
| 21 | Boston Trust & Investment Management Co. | $1,978.0 |
| 22 | Samson Capital Advisors LLC | $1,404.1 |
| 23 | Kornitzer Capital Management Inc. | $1,343.0 |
| 24 | Parnassus Investments | $1,202.9 |
| 25 | T. Rowe Price Associates Inc. | $1,173.0 |
| 26 | AEW Capital Management LP | $1,076.8 |
| 27 | Kingdon Capital Management LLC | $882.0 |
| 28 | RidgeWorth Capital Management Inc. | $800.0 |
| 29 | Thompson Siegel & Walmsley LLC | $727.8 |
| 30 | Evanston Capital Management LLC | $699.0 |
| 31 | Baillie Gifford Overseas Ltd. | $650.0 |
| 32 | Cavanal Hill Investment Management Inc. | $640.8 |
| 33 | McDonnell Investment Management LLC | $621.0 |
| 34 | Vaughan Nelson Investment Management LP | $602.0 |
| 35 | Westfield Capital Management Co. LP | $578.0 |
| 36 | Sit Investment Associates Inc. | $576.0 |
| 37 | Farr Miller & Washington LLC | $541.8 |
| 38 | Cambiar Investors LLC | $486.6 |
| 39 | Flippin Bruce & Porter Inc. | $466.0 |
| 40 | Mount Lucas Management Corp. | $440.0 |
| 41 | Cramer Rosenthal McGlynn LLC | $438.0 |
| 42 | Aberdeen Asset Management Inc. | $434.0 |
| 43 | Nuveen Investments | $427.5 |
| 44 | Colchester Global Investors Ltd. | $413.0 |
| 45 | TCW Group | $377.0 |
| 46 | New Boston Fund Inc. | $375.7 |
| 47 | Income Research & Management | $373.0 |
| 48 | RCM Capital Management LLC | $368.0 |
| 49 | Colony Capital LLC | $350.0 |
| 50 | The London Co. | $316.2 |
| Total | $453,473.2 | |
| As of Dec. 31. * Those with $100M in investible assets. Data based on responses of 711 asset management firms in the May 2011 directory of the largest money managers. | ||
